EU261 compensation on this route

About ~2,363 km · in case of disruption you may be entitled to up to €400 (Regulation EC 261/2004).

The Palma de Mallorca (PMI) → Stockholm (NYO) route is operated by Ryanair. Heading to Stockholm: what to expect in this direction

Flying from Palma de Mallorca (PMI) to Stockholm (NYO) heads north for about 2,363 km, a flight time of roughly 3h 22m.

Air-traffic congestion: departing Palma de Mallorca the average ATFM delay is 1.5 min (atfm); arriving into Stockholm it is 2.0 min (atfm).

The Palma de Mallorca-Stockholm route is about 2,363 km: for a cancellation (with less than 14 days' notice), a delay over 3 hours, or denied boarding, EU261 compensation is €400, barring extraordinary circumstances.
